Perl 教程 之 Perl 哈希 6

简介: 读取哈希的 key 和 value

Perl 教程 之 Perl 哈希 6

Perl 哈希

读取哈希的 key 和 value

读取所有key

我们可以使用 keys 函数读取哈希所有的键,语法格式如下:

keys %HASH
该函数返回所有哈希的所有 key 的数组。

类似的我们可以使用 values 函数来读取哈希所有的值,语法格式如下:

values %HASH
该函数返回所有哈希的所有 value 的数组。

实例

!/usr/bin/perl

%data = ('google'=>'google.com', 'baidu'=>'baidu.com', 'taobao'=>'taobao.com');

@urls = values %data;

print "$urls[0]\n";
print "$urls[1]\n";
print "$urls[2]\n";
执行以上程序,输出结果为:

taobao.com
baidu.com
google.com

目录
相关文章
|
7月前
|
Perl
Perl 教程 之 Perl 哈希 12
三元运算符 ? :
33 5
|
7月前
|
Perl
|
7月前
|
Perl
|
7月前
|
Perl
|
7月前
|
Perl
Perl 教程 之 Perl 哈希 3
访问哈希元素
40 4
|
7月前
|
Perl
|
7月前
|
Perl
|
7月前
|
存储 索引 Perl
|
7月前
|
存储 Perl
Perl 教程 之 Perl 数组 10
将数组转换为字符串
71 6
|
7月前
|
存储 索引 Perl